Ceramic metering pumps stand out in various industrial applications due to their high efficiency and precision in fluid handling. With their innovative design, these pumps minimize flow rate fluctuations, ensuring consistent delivery of media. The precision offered is crucial in industries requiring exact dosing, such as pharmaceuticals and food processing.
The use of ceramic materials provides excellent resistance to corrosive substances. In industries that handle aggressive chemicals, ceramic metering pumps can maintain operational integrity without significant wear and tear. This durability reduces replacement costs and downtime, contributing to overall operational efficiency.
One of the key benefits of ceramic metering pumps is their extended lifespan compared to traditional materials. The inherent hardness and strength of ceramics protect against abrasion and degradation. As a result, industries can experience lower maintenance costs, allowing for budget reallocations towards other critical areas of production.
Ceramic metering pumps are designed to provide precise flow control, which is essential in processes that require exact amounts of fluids. The ability to maintain steady flow rates aids in achieving consistent product quality, an important factor in industries such as personal care and cosmetics.
These pumps can withstand high temperatures without sacrificing performance. This capability is particularly beneficial in industrial settings where processes may generate heat, ensuring that the pump functions reliably under various conditions without the risk of material degradation.
Ceramic metering pumps are versatile in handling a wide range of fluids, from viscous liquids to abrasive slurries. This adaptability makes them suitable for many industries, including chemical manufacturing, oil and gas, and water treatment. Their ability to accommodate various media enhances operational flexibility.
Utilizing ceramic metering pumps contributes to environmental sustainability. Their efficiency helps reduce energy consumption, lowering the carbon footprint associated with industrial processes. Additionally, these pumps often use fewer lubricants and coolants, leading to a decrease in waste generation.
In industries where product purity is paramount, ceramic metering pumps reduce the risk of contamination. The materials used in these pumps do not leach harmful substances into the fluids, making them ideal for food and pharmaceutical applications. This safety aspect supports compliance with stringent industry regulations.
